代码语言:javascript 复制 p1|p2 上下拼图 使用/拼图 代码语言:javascript 复制 p1/p2 嵌套拼图 代码语言:javascript 复制 (p1|p2)/p3 控制布局 Patchwork 包提供了几个函数来控制组合图形的布局。 默认布局 代码语言:javascript 复制 p1+p2+p3+p4 plot_layout 控制布局 代码语言:javascript 复制 p1+p2+p3+p4+p...
Python patchworklib库还支持批量处理补丁文件,可以一次性对多个补丁文件进行操作,提高处理效率。 示例代码:批量应用补丁 from patchworklib import Patch # 加载多个补丁文件 patch_files = ['patch1.patch', 'patch2.patch', 'patch3.patch'] patches = [Patch(open(file, 'r').read()) for file in patch...
代码语言:javascript 复制 p1+p2+p3 添加plot_spacer() 函数。 代码语言:javascript 复制 p1+p2+plot_spacer()+p3 如图所示,plot_spacer() 函数就是在前后图形中创建一个空的透明网格,可以提高自定义排版的自由度。 代码语言:javascript 复制 p1+plot_spacer()+p2+plot_spacer()+p3+plot_spacer() 4. 调整...
另外,可以使用布局函数plot_layout对拼接细节进行更细致地指定,像每个图的范围,图形的排列。 代码语言:javascript 复制 p1+p2+plot_layout(ncol=1,heights=c(3,1)) 如果你想要在图形之间添加一些空间,可以使用plot_spacer()填充一个空白格。 代码语言:javascript 复制 p1+plot_spacer()+p2 增加花括号的使用进行...
1. 维护代码 在软件开发过程中,经常需要对代码进行更新和维护,而使用patchworklib库可以方便地管理和应用代码补丁,保持代码库的稳定性和更新性。 示例代码:应用补丁文件 frompatchworklib import Patch# 加载补丁文件patch_file =open('example.patch','r') ...
patchwork.ffmpeg.org 里面未被选中的优秀代码 很多程序员为 FFMpeg 增加新功能写出代码, 把写好的代码 git send-email 邮件方式提交 patch 文件 发送给 patchwork.ffmpeg.org; 一直认为 FFMpeg 中的 delogo 滤镜不够完美, 想在 patchwork.ffmpeg.org 里面能不能找到相关的代码, 结果发现真的有;...
void main(){ double X;double Y;Lyhdian cc(0,0);cout<<"请输入一点的坐标:"<<endl;cin>>X>>Y;Lyhdian aa(X,Y);cout<<"请输入另一点的坐标:"<<endl;cin>>X>>Y;Lyhdian bb(X,Y);cout<<"两点进行加运算:"<<endl;cc=aa+bb;cc.show();cout<<"两点进行减运算:"<<endl;...
记下来是四个柱形图的代码 library(ggplot2) panel_b <- ggplot(binding_summary, aes(reorder(Target_Pathway,num_gene), num_gene)) + geom_bar(stat = "identity", fill = "black") + coord_flip() + theme_bw() + ylab("Number of genes") + xlab("Pathway") + theme( ...
做柱形图的数据和代码下载链接 https://github.com/melletang/ccp_y1h 首先是读取数据 library(tidyverse)library(readxl)network<-readxl::read_excel("MSB-2021-10625-DatasetEV3-Network.xls",sheet="CC_Y1H_network") 整理数据的代码 binding_summary<-network%>%select(Promoter_AGI,Target_Pathway)%>%unique...
Patchwork是一个基于Django框架开发的社区项目,专注于提供补丁跟踪的系统化解决方案。该项目的核心目标在于简化补丁管理流程,使项目贡献者和维护者能够将更多精力投入到关键性及更具创新性的任务中。Patchwork具备自动从邮件列表中捕获补丁的功能,并以丰富的代码示例展示,便于用户直观理解补丁的功能与操作。